posted June 01, 2014 11:55 AM
Edited by Kicferk at 11:56, 01 Jun 2014.

Alright, I just tested, additional health points do not cause increased xp reward. At least the ones granted by stack experience. And I think the map "The Dragon Slaughter" is a great example for the very same fact, creatures are gaining large health boosts in there and yet they give constant amount of XP.

I used WoG 3,58f
